Legislative Director Overview: The Legislative Director serves as the primary advocate and liaison for the City of Alexandria with the Virginia General Assembly, the Governor's administration, and federal policymakers. This position is responsible for advancing the City's legislative agenda at the state and federal levels, ensuring alignment with strategic priorities, and fostering collaborative relationships to support Alexandria's policy and budgetary goals.
About the City Manager's Office: The Alexandria City Manager is appointed by the City Council to be the chief administrative officer of the City. The City Manager's administrative staff serves as a liaison with City departments and with other governmental entities receiving funding from the City, but not reporting to the City Manager, and generally administers the City government. Key Responsibilities:
State Legislative Advocacy
Lead the development, presentation, and execution of the City's legislative agenda during General Assembly sessions.
Monitor and analyze state legislation, budget proposals, and policy developments that impact the City.
Build and maintain strong working relationships with members of the General Assembly, the Governor's administration, and legislative staff.
Provide timely updates and strategic recommendations to City leadership regarding legislative activities and their implications.
Federal Legislative Advocacy
Manage the City's federal lobbying program to ensure alignment with the City's priorities and effective advocacy efforts.
Develop and advance the City's federal legislative package, focusing on policy and budget priorities.
Build and maintain relationships with the City's congressional delegation and their staff to advocate for Alexandria's federal interests.
Monitor federal legislation, regulatory changes, and appropriations opportunities that could affect the City.
Coordinate advocacy efforts for federal funding and grant opportunities in partnership with City departments and external stakeholders.
Policy and Stakeholder Engagement
Collaborate with City departments to identify and align legislative priorities with operational needs.
Represent the City's interests in meetings, hearings, and discussions with state and federal stakeholders.
Foster partnerships with other local governments, municipal associations, and regional organizations to support shared legislative goals.
Legislative Tracking and Reporting
Track and manage all state and federal legislation relevant to the City, identifying risks and opportunities.
Prepare clear, concise reports and briefings for City Council, the City Manager, and department heads on legislative matters.
Budget Advocacy
Advocate for state and federal funding to support the City's projects and initiatives.
Engage with state and federal budget committees and agencies to advance Alexandria's financial interests.
Public Communication and Outreach
Communicate the City's legislative efforts and successes to residents, businesses, and other stakeholders.
Draft public statements, testimony, and correspondence on behalf of City leadership.
Administrative Oversight
Manage the legislative team and consultants, ensuring effective coordination and resource allocation.
Ensure compliance with lobbying disclosure requirements and reporting obligations.
This role requires a deep understanding of legislative processes at both the state and federal levels, exceptional political acumen, and the ability to prioritize key responsibilities to maximize the City's success in achieving its policy and budgetary objectives. Minimum: Four-Year College Degree; at least five years of experience in government at the Federal, State, or local level; or any equivalent combination of experience and training which provides the required knowledge, skills, and abilities. Must have significant experience in the legislative process, experience working with the Virginia General Assembly and navigating Virginia's state legislative process, and some knowledge of or experience in the Federal legislative process. Significant experience with written and verbal presentations. Master's Degree or law degree and will have experience in multiple levels/areas of government (i.e., local/state/federal; executive and legislative). Additional experience in State and Federal budget development desired. Virginia State legislative experience is highly desirable for this position.Experience working with the Virginia General Assembly and navigating Virginia's state legislative process.The work of this position requires the temporary relocation to Richmond, Virginia when the Virginia General Assembly is in session, as well as weekly trips back and forth between Alexandria and Richmond when the General Assembly is in session, as well as frequent trips to Richmond during the balance of the year to attend legislative committee and other meetings. The City funds the cost of the temporary relocations, as well as travel and other expenses. The primary work location for this position is the City of Alexandria.
